## Formula sandbox tuning

User-supplied formulas in Gridmoor execute inside a restricted interpreter with hard ceilings on time, memory, and call depth. Reviewers should confirm any change to these ceilings is justified in the PR description, since raising them widens the abuse surface. Defaults were chosen from production traces. The current limits are as follows.

limits module of tafog-fawip:
WEIGHTS = {
    "julix": 57,
    "lamys": 992,
    "kasvan": 209,
    "quenok": 750,
    "alddor": 259,
    "oliath": 1009,
    "wenix": 815,
}

- [ ] Step 7: Archive cold storage buckets (Glacierline tier). Confirm both ceremony witnesses are present, verify bucket manifests match the Oxbow ledger, then seal the archive key shares. Plugin authors may observe but not handle shares. Once sealed, the archive index itself is encrypted and can only be reopened with the passphrase below.

vault phrase of badup-hahig = tamael-aldael-kelmir-istael-fenok-istwyn-tamius-jorath-oliion

## Deployment

Hey on-call — deploying the Crashloft pipeline is mostly painless. The ingest workers pull crash dumps from the Fernwick app, symbolicate them, and push summaries into the triage queue. Roll out with the usual blue/green script; symbolication caches warm up in about ten minutes, so expect slow first reports. If the queue backs up past 5k, bump worker count before panicking. Don't restart the dedup shard mid-flush or you'll double-count crashes. The values the staging environment currently runs with are as follows.

deployment values, kajep-kageg:
[praix]
host = praix.paliqcorp.corp
user = praix_svc
database = praix_prod

UserSplit Cutover Drift: the extracted account service and the legacy Marigold monolith user module are reporting divergent record counts during dual-write. This fires when drift exceeds 0.5% over 15 minutes. New team members should not replay writes manually. Reconciliation steps and the rollback procedure are documented on the internal page.

wiki page, tajog-fafog: https://gitlab.paliqsys.corp/dash/display/job/853dd6fcbf54